Propagation of Gaussian beams through a multi-Gaussian apertured ABCD system

  • 1. Department of Electronic Information and Engineering, Yibin College, Yibin, 644007;
  • 2. Institute of Laser Physics and Chemistry, Sichuan University, Chengdu, 610064;
  • 3. National Laboratory of Laser Technology, HUST, Wuhan, 430074

Abstract: Based on the Collins formula and Sylvester theorem,the propagation equation of Gaussian beams passing through a multi-Gaussian apertured paraxial optical ABCD system is derived.The application of the equation is illustrated with numerical examples.
